Le87536 Overview
The Le87536 is a dual channel differential amplifier designed to drive full rate ADSL2+ signals with very low power dissipation. The Le87536 contains two pairs of wide band amplifiers designed with Zarlink’s HV30 Bipolar SOI process for low power consumption in DSL systems. The amplifiers have an internal fixed gain, which helps to eliminate external feedback and gain setting resistors.
Le87536 Key Features
- Fixed Voltage Gain Of 13
- 450 mA Peak Output Drive Capability
- ±5 V to ±12 V Dual Supplies Or 10 V to 24 V
- 44 Vp-p Differential Output Into a 100 Ω Load
- 40.5 Vp-p Differential Output Into a 60 Ω Load
- Low-power Disable Mode For Each Driver
- 4 mA Per Amplifier Quiescent Supply Current
- 75dBc THD With 1MHz Signal Into a 60 Ω load
- 16-pin (4 mm x 4 mm) QFN Package
